The Board of Trustees (BOT), Nigerian Community Leeds, being the bona fide representative of Nigerians in Leeds welcome the historic appointment of one of our own, Councillor Abigail Marshall Katung to the esteemed position of the Lord Mayor of Leeds, the first citizen of Leeds, for the term 2024-25.
Councillor Marshall Katung has already made history as the first elected African Councillor in Leeds in the history of the Council. She is currently the Chair of Scrutiny Board for Infrastructure, Investment and Inclusive Growth. Councillor Abigail has previously held other senior posts including Lead member for Race/BAME, Lead member for Faith & Belief amongst others. She is also Co-Chair of David Oluwale Memorial Association (DOMA) and plays a strategic leadership role for the Leeds African Communities Trust, an umbrella organisation for African Communities in Leeds.
